Owyhee Canyonlands

As part of the Protect the Owyhee Canyonlands coalition’s efforts, the Center for Western Priorities (CWP) has released a new video highlighting the Owyhee’s land, wildlife, and cultural history and the urgent need for permanent protection.

Featured spokespeople include: Wilson Wewa, Northern Paiute Tribe elder, traditional knowledge keeper, and spiritual leader; Karly Foster, Campaign Manager, Oregon Natural Desert Association; Tim Davis, Founder and Executive Director, Friends of the Owyhee; Julie Weikel, Retired large animal veterinarian and Owyhee advocate. Video by Center for Western Priorities.

Environment America and Environment Oregon are part of the Protect the Owyhee Canyonlands grassroots advocacy coalition along with the Center for Western Priorities, which is a project of the Resources Legacy Fund.
